Flipper Zero is a versatile tool but it has limits. It cannot perform high-power tasks like de-authentication attacks due to its low transmission power. It is not intended for activities beyond legal and ethical boundaries, like unauthorized access to devices or networks. The device also has a finite battery life and requires regular charging. To maximize its utility, focus on its intended educational and research purposes.
